Forge of Empires. Iron Age Military Units. There are five basic military classes of unit with characteristics that are similar in every age. To begin with in the Iron Age there are light soldiers, heavy soldiers, archers, cavalry and artillery. As you advance through the ages, these units will be modernised and equipped with better armour and

Sep 2, 2016. #4. goods (until late middle age) are needed for 4 ages in the tech tree. the age where they are produced and the following 3. and to build the 2 GB of that age (and bronze age goods also for the Observatory) if you have done that you don't need those goods anymore. later goods (colonial age) are also needed later

Also, Bronze Age cities typically have Bronze Age neighboring cities with maybe a few Iron Age cities in the mix. An Iron Age city's neighbors will range from Bronze through to Early Middle Ages, as neighbors shift as one goes up in ages.

In the Bronze Age, slings were first used by herders to protect their flocks. Eventually they were used in warfare, being one of the first ranged weapons. Slingers could fire 10 stones in a minute, and while accuracy was medicore, it was used until arrows were introduced. The great range that slings had surpassed even the bow and arrow.

Nov 4, 2021. #3. Presuming you have access to a 1.9 thread, to achieve an incremental 10% in attack it will cost about 5000fps for Zeus, or about 5500 for CoA, or about 6000 for CdM. Not considering the cost of the goods, taking a TA to level 5 will get you the 10% attack increase at a cost of about 1000fps.
